Email from Sedo said:
Dear *******:

In the continued effort to maintain a successful and secure marketplace, Sedo recently initiated a Buyer Certification program. Your account has automatically been updated to a certified buyer account as we have successfully completed a transaction in the past. New customers must certify their accounts before submitting offers. There are three methods available for new customers become certified buyers: including credit card verification, signed Buyer Certification Statement, Completed W9 form (available to member in the US and Canada) or through an SMS certification code.

You will see an additional tab in the “My Sedo” navigation menu for the Buyer Certification page. Again, no action is required from you as you are already a certified buyer. We hope that you are pleased with this improvement which was designed to allow us to maintain a secure marketplace where transactions are carried out smoothly and efficiently.

We appreciate your business and as always if you have any questions please feel free to contact us at [email protected] .

I like this feature
However i find the SMS verification the weekest method of all
I don't know the procedure of the SMS but these are used for contests and such.

It's not a financial info, the user can turn off the phone, don't reply, continue to submit false data without a problem and don't forget that it's very easy (and many already have) more than one cell phone
